Price Evaluation And Advantages
Cost elements are a key factor when car buyers consider OEM against replacement parts. OEM components, typically sourced straight from the vehicle manufacturer, tend to command a steeper cost as a result of their guaranteed quality and fit. On the flip side, replacement parts are generally more affordable, appealing to budget-aware consumers. Still, the lower price of replacement options may involve trade-offs, encompassing conceivable variations in standards and fit. Though OEM components provide peak performance and lifespan, aftermarket alternatives may work well for used cars or less critical upkeep. Fundamentally, the decision depends on the owner's priorities: whether to prioritize dependability and operation or to slash costs with possibly less dependable alternatives.
How to Identify Authentic OEM Parts?
What separates authentic original equipment manufacturer components from their imitation versions? Genuine original equipment manufacturer parts are created by the source manufacturer, providing compatibility and quality standards. They feature particular branding, logos, and serial numbers that can be confirmed against the manufacturer's catalog.
To identify authentic components, consumers should copyrightine containers for holograms or security seals, which often show authenticity. Also, reviewing the part's serial number against the manufacturer's database can establish its authenticity.
Buying from official distributors or reputable sources is imperative, as these avenues are more apt to stock legitimate items. In opposition, bogus components may look similar but often possess insufficient the durability and performance of OEM substitutes.
At last, cost can be a clear indicator; if a deal seems too good to be true, it frequently is. Understanding these characteristics can help guarantee that car owners choose parts that strengthen performance and safety.
